Here's what I recommend if you do go:
Daytime:
-Walk along the river to check out the views, and stop at this old mill they turned into an art museum and restaurant. At the restaurant, you can sit outside overlooking the huge river and eat for very reasonable prices. If it's a weekend, they will also have a Feria right around the corner.
-Go to the Casino. It was brand new when I went and it's Vegas quality inside. Poker is 5peso/10peso blinds for the cash game. The same building also has some other semi-interesting things to do to (such as bowling) to kill time if you need to.
-For dining, actually there are some ok options. Walk along Av. Pellegrini near Italia for a lot of good Parrillas and other fine dining.
-Parque Independencia seemed like a very nice and well maintained park, although I only saw it from the taxi.
